Save
Web Page Logo Technology Brand, PNG, 1782x873px, Web Page, Area, Brand, Communication, Diagram Download Free
User Draekyn uploaded this Step Process - Web Page Logo Technology Brand PNG PNG image on December 9, 2023, 8:19 pm. The resolution of this file is 1782x873px and its file size is: 156.30 KB. This PNG image is filed under the tags:
Download PNG (156.30 KB)

Step Process - Web Page Logo Technology Brand PNG

Edit PNG
AI Background Remover
1782x873
156.30 KB
December 9, 2023
PNG (300 DPI)